Data protection – Information for customers
Pelican Self Storage Group (“Pelican Self Storage“, “we” or “us“) may at any time store information about private individuals and use such information for various purposes. This information is intended for all individuals, for example customers, who use Pelican Self Storage’s services and products. Information about individuals is referred to as “personal data“.
What types of personal data are stored and used by Pelican Self Storage?
We receive personal data from individuals and from other sources, and the data is broadly divided into the following categories:
• identification details such as name, address, bank account details, CPR number,
• contact details such as email address, telephone number,
• service and product details such as information about the services or products purchased or used by an individual,
• communication details such as customer enquiries,
• segmentation details such as why a customer needs a storage unit

What is our legal basis for storing and using personal data?
We may use personal data where an agreement exists. For example, if an individual purchases a service or product from Pelican Self Storage, the individual’s contact details may be used to process payment or to deliver the product. In certain cases, we obtain prior consent to use personal data. Individuals may at any time withdraw their consent to the collection, use, disclosure, or other processing of their personal data. In certain cases, we may use personal data to comply with legal obligations to which Pelican Self Storage is subject, or where Pelican Self Storage has a legitimate interest that justifies the use of personal data for a specific purpose.

How long is personal data stored?
Personal data is stored by Pelican Self Storage or by other parties on our behalf, but only for as long as necessary to fulfil our obligations and only for as long as necessary to achieve the purposes for which the data was collected. The personal data is removed from our records or anonymised when it is no longer necessary. Personal data in contracts, communications, and business correspondence may be subject to statutory retention requirements, which may require retention for up to 10 years. Other personal data is, in principle, deleted no later than two years after the most recent interaction and business contact with the individual. Longer retention periods may apply for backup copies of personal data for security reasons. However, access to the personal data will be strictly limited.

What are the individual’s rights?
Consent that we have obtained to store or use personal data may be withdrawn at any time. In addition, individuals are entitled to:
i. Right of access: Individuals have the right to ask us whether we hold personal data about them and, if so, to request information about which personal data we hold. We are also obliged to answer questions about why we use personal data, details of what data we hold, and who we have granted access to the data. However, this is not an absolute right, and the interests of other individuals may limit the right of access.
ii. Right to rectification: Upon request, we are obliged to correct inaccurate personal data or complete incomplete personal data.
iii. Right to erasure (the right to be forgotten): In some situations, we are obliged to erase personal data at the request of the individual concerned.
iv. Right to restriction of processing: In some situations, we are obliged to restrict our use of personal data at the request of the individual concerned. In such cases, we may only use the data for certain limited statutory purposes.
v. Right to data portability: Under certain circumstances, individuals may have the right to receive their personal data to which we have access in a structured, commonly used, machine-readable format, and such individuals may then have the right to transfer that data to other entities without hindrance from us.
vi. Right to object: In some cases, individuals have the right to object to our use of their personal data. In such cases, we may be required to cease using the personal data. An example of such a situation is where personal data is used for marketing and profiling purposes.

Recordings of outgoing telephone calls
At Pelican Self Storage, we value a high standard of customer service and security. To ensure that agreements relating to entering into contracts and contract changes can be documented, we record telephone calls.
The recordings will be handled in accordance with applicable data protection legislation and will be stored for a maximum of 3 months, after which they will be deleted.
